At its core, effective succession planning involves identifying key roles and assessing current talent pools internally. This process requires a comprehensive analysis of each employee’s skills, experience, and potential, often enhanced by insights from human resources departments and leadership teams. For instance, a technology company might identify the need to groom a young IT director as the next CEO, taking into account their technical acumen, strategic thinking, and ability to adapt to evolving cybersecurity landscapes—all while ensuring compliance with relevant data privacy laws. This proactive approach minimizes the risks associated with sudden leadership changes and fosters a culture of continuous development.

A comprehensive approach involves drafting detailed succession plans that consider not just the transfer of assets but also the continuation of legal and regulatory obligations. This includes reviewing corporate governance structures, updating bylaws, and ensuring alignment with relevant laws and industry standards.
Best practices dictate regular reviews and updates to these plans, as business landscapes evolve rapidly. Engaging in open dialogue between owners, executives, and legal counsel facilitates a smoother transition. The Eastman Law Firm encourages proactive measures like identifying potential successors early, establishing clear roles and responsibilities, and implementing succession training programs.
